Chemistry Check: Assessing Compatibility With Muslim Singles
Start by acknowledging attraction, then move toward the practical: ask whether your core values and life goals align. For many Muslim singles, faith can be a guiding framework, but people express belief and practice in different ways. Gently explore what religion means to each of you—daily practices, community involvement, cultural traditions, and how faith shapes decisions about family, holidays, and parenting.
Talk About Long-Term Goals And Lifestyle Fit
Discuss where you see your life in 1–5 years. Are you both aiming for marriage, or are you exploring companionship first? Talk about career plans, relocation willingness, living arrangements, and expectations around work–family balance. Clear conversation about these topics early prevents misaligned assumptions later.
Communication Style And Decision Making
Pay attention to how you disagree and how you resolve small conflicts. Share your preferred communication patterns: direct or gentle feedback, how you like to receive support, and how much emotional openness you expect. Decide together how major choices—finances, moving, children—will be made and who will be involved in those conversations.
Boundaries And Family Roles
Families often play an important role. Ask about family expectations, involvement, and boundaries. Clarify your own limits—privacy, social life, time with extended family, and financial responsibilities—so both people understand what support looks like without feeling pressured.
Respectful Questions To Ask Early
- What does practicing faith look like in your daily life?
- How do you imagine balancing family, work, and personal time?
- What are your views on marriage, kids, and parenting roles?
- How involved are your family and what role would they play in major decisions?
- How do you handle disagreements and what helps you feel heard?
- Are there non-negotiables for you—religious practices, lifestyle habits, or boundaries?
Listen as much as you speak. Chemistry is important, but compatibility grows from shared values, honest communication, and mutual respect. Dating Confidence Reset
Start by clarifying what you want from dating right now. Decide whether you’re exploring casually, open to something serious, or simply practicing conversation skills. Writing down one or two clear intentions helps you respond to matches with purpose instead of reacting to every notification.
Set realistic expectations and pace
Remind yourself that meaningful connections usually take time. Aim for steady progress—short, consistent conversations that build to a phone call or video chat when both people seem comfortable. Avoid the numbers-game mindset that pushes you to message dozens of people at once; quality over quantity reduces burnout and makes it easier to notice who truly fits your needs.
Use boundaries to protect your energy
- Limit daily app time so dating doesn’t dominate your schedule.
- Decide in advance how many new conversations you’ll keep active at once.
- If a chat drains you or feels disrespectful, step back or pause communication—respecting yourself is attractive and practical.
Look for small signs of progress
Track realistic indicators that a match is worth your time: consistent replies, reciprocal questions, and follow-through on plans. Celebrate these small wins instead of waiting for big outcomes. That sense of forward motion builds confidence.
Ask clearer questions and share what matters
Short, specific questions reveal values and habits faster than vague small talk. Share a concise sentence about what matters to you—work-life balance, hobbies, family time—so you filter matches earlier and avoid time-consuming mismatches.
Keep emotions steady and practical
When a message goes cold or a date doesn’t lead anywhere, treat it as data, not a verdict on your worth. Take a short break if needed, reset your intentions, and re-enter with the same simple standards you started with.
Make selective choices
Use your preferences to guide who you invest time in. Being choosy isn’t mean—it’s efficient. It helps you focus on people who are more likely to meet your needs and makes each interaction feel more meaningful.
